The Transformative Power of Senior Leadership Programs
Senior leadership programs are designed to cultivate the next generation of leaders. Unlike generic management training, these programs focus on advanced strategic thinking, complex problem-solving, and navigating the intricacies of organizational politics. They go beyond the basics, delving into:
- Strategic Vision & Planning: Developing the ability to craft compelling long-term strategies, aligning resources effectively, and adapting to market shifts.
- Change Management: Mastering the art of guiding organizations through periods of transformation, fostering buy-in and minimizing disruption.
- Financial Acumen: Gaining a deeper understanding of financial statements, budgeting, and resource allocation to make informed, data-driven decisions.
- Executive Communication: Refining communication skills to influence stakeholders, build consensus, and effectively present complex information.
- Team Leadership & Mentorship: Developing strategies to build high-performing teams, nurture talent, and foster a culture of collaboration and innovation.
- Global Leadership &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ion (DE&I): Understanding and navigating the complexities of operating in a globalized marketplace, while promoting inclusion and equity within teams.
These programs are far more than simple lectures; they're immersive experiences often involving:
- Interactive Workshops: Collaborative sessions that encourage peer learning and knowledge sharing.
- Case Studies: Analyzing real-world business scenarios to apply theoretical knowledge practically.
- Simulations: Engaging in realistic business simulations to test strategic decision-making under pressure.
- Executive Coaching: Receiving personalized mentorship from experienced leaders to address specific areas for improvement.
- Networking Opportunities: Building relationships with peers and industry leaders, broadening your professional network.
Who Should Consider Senior Leadership Programs?
These programs are beneficial for a wide range of professionals, including:
- High-potential employees: Individuals identified as future leaders within their organizations.
- Mid-level managers: Those aspiring to move into senior management roles.
- Executive-level professionals: Seeking to refine their existing skills and stay ahead of the curve.
- Entrepreneurs: Looking to enhance their strategic thinking and leadership capabilities.
The programs cater to various experience levels, offering customized curricula to meet individual needs. The key is recognizing the need for continuous professional development and a desire to push beyond existing comfort zones.

Choosing the Right Senior Leadership Program
With a multitude of programs available, selecting the right one is crucial. Consider factors such as:
- Program curriculum: Ensure the program aligns with your specific leadership goals and career aspirations.
- Faculty and instructors: Look for programs led by experienced and respected industry experts.
- Program format: Consider your learning style and choose a program that suits your preferences (in-person, online, hybrid).
- Program reputation and accreditation: Choose a reputable program with a proven track record of success.
- Cost and investment: Weigh the cost of the program against the potential return on investment.
